About Us

At the Department of Public Works, we are responsible for building and maintaining a sustainable provincial infrastructure for Nova Scotians. From highways and bridges to government buildings and registration of vehicles, safety and quality of life are top of mind. We support Nova Scotia’s 23,000 kilometers of roads and highways, 4,100 bridges, and 9 provincial ferries.

Our Fleet Services Division is pivotal in ensuring the Public Works Fleet is running smoothly; ensuring the safety of our provincial road network.

About Our Opportunity

As the Mobile Service Mechanic, you will have the opportunity to work on our wide variety of equipment that maintains our roads and highways. You will be responsible for maintaining Utility Tractors, Rubber Tire Loaders, Graders, Tandem Trucks and all associated attachments including wings, plows, and sweepers.

Primary Accountabilities

You will not only repair, rebuild and make adjustments to our fleet, but also determine the reasoning for equipment malfunctions. To minimize such occurrences, preventative maintenance is a critical component in this role.

We will ensure you have the right tools to do the job, and there is nothing more important than your safety. You have a clean workspace, and your ideas and input are valued and considered. Your coveralls and other personal protective equipment (PPE) are provided. We also have an annual footwear and tool reimbursement allowance as you must bring your own mechanical tools.

Qualifications and Experience

Some high school and an Inter-Provincial Red Seal Certificate of Qualification in Truck and Transport plus a minimum of five (5) years of diversified mechanical experience.

Upon hire, applicants will be required to successfully complete Nova Scotia Motor Vehicle Inspection (MVI) training as part of their probationary requirements.

A valid Nova Scotia driver\’s license with Air Brakes and acceptable driving record is required. Please include a current Driver\’s Abstract with your application.

Knowledge and experience of computer-controlled engine diagnostic technology, electrical schematics, dealer purchased engine programs, online service manuals, and safety inspections are considered assets.

Air Conditioning Certification and a Motor Vehicle Inspection license would also be considered assets.

You consistently demonstrate initiative in your role, remaining up to date in changes to equipment, methods and technology within the mechanical field. Strong communication skills are necessary for the times when you will be helping staff diagnose and resolve equipment issues. You must also be able to work effectively with minimal supervision as most of your time will be spent working independently. Professionalism and a high standard for client and customer service is required.

Working Conditions

Given the nature of this role, Mobile Mechanics must be comfortable working independently in the field and traveling throughout their designated region to fix equipment. Travel may include both urban and rural locations.

Work is performed in a mechanical repair environment occasioned by noise, smoke and gas fumes and at times adverse weather conditions while operating in a field environment. Considerable standing, lifting, carrying and moving about is a requirement of this position.
